| [Top page. This is the back of the
third page for the April 2nd entry, and is opposite the blank page
after the entry for April 6th in the microfilm.] |
Senior Rear Admiral on retired list (with full pay?) R. Ad - pennant
with diagonal white bar.
Work done while under special orders
[inserted vertically:] countersigned by the President.
therefore in line of duty. Has cost Govt nothing, while it gains all the prestige. At head of list of such
names as Franklin(?) McClintock, Ross Parry, Kane Hall, DeLong, etc.
etc.
England promoted & knighted dozens & paid thousands in
rewards. Note promotions Greely, Schley, Melville Pres. Am. Geog. Soc.
8th Int. Geog. Cong.
Hon. Men. & Gold Medal list of principal honors &
foreign Geog. Socs.
[Vertically in margin:] Navy record a good
one. Nicaragua Canal Slated for Bureau by everyone but Pres. R-
[Roosevelt]
